Chinese Crystal Stone Formula Expels Horse Bladder Stones

Veterinarians define horse bladder stones as a concretion of minerals. Calcium comprises most horse bladder stones. The location of the stone in the body dictates the classification of the stone. “Cysto” means “bladder”. Therefore, cystoliths are bladder stones. Nephroliths are kidney stones. Chinese Herbal Blend Max's Formula Shrinks Horse Tumors

Horse tumors occur in all horse breeds and ages. Skin tumors are the most common. Some causes of non-cancerous horse tumors are: Abscesses Fatty tumors Sebaceous cysts Warts. The three most common cancerous horse tumors are: Sarcoids Melanomas Squamous Cell Carcinoma.
